14:22 — Offline sync regression confirmed (Terrapath field-survey app)

At 14:22 the on-call engineer reproduced the data-loss path: surveys saved while offline were marked synced once connectivity returned, even when the upload was rejected. The queue flush skipped the server acknowledgement check introduced in the previous sprint. Release manager note: the fix must ship before the coastal survey season. The offending build is identified by the token recorded below.

session token of kawif-fawig = htk31_f3f599be2b1a34affb1efa8d0feccf8

Handover Note — Office Closure

Dana, as you take over the Western district, note that the Kellport satellite office closes at quarter-end. Lease termination is filed, staff reassignments are agreed, and equipment disposal is with facilities. Two admin roles transfer to the Marrow Bay hub. Remaining tasks are listed in the closure tracker. Before your first leadership call, read the following carefully.

internal memo for kawip-hadug: Headcount on the Wenwyn team goes from 7 to 140 by the end of January. Gross margin on Wenwyn came in at 20 percent against a plan of 15 percent.

## Changelog — Tidemark Widget 3.2

Defaults changed. Read before touching anything.

- Refresh interval now hourly, not every 15 min. Harbor feeds from the Pellisport aggregator throttle aggressive polling.
- Lunar-offset correction is on by default. Disable only for legacy Kestrel Bay deployments.
- Chart units default to metric. The imperial fallback flag is deprecated and will be removed in 3.4.
- Cache eviction is now time-based, not size-based.

New installs should start from the default configuration values listed below.

config for kahap-taweg:
oliox:
  pin: 8609
  tenant: casath
  seal: seal_632a4a6f
  metrics_host: metrics.oliox.nelvrogrid.example
  standby_team: keleth
  escalation: briiel-oliwyn
  nonce: e2397c

Hey facilities — Marisol from Oakdene Fit-Outs starts her first week on Monday, doing the ceiling tile survey on floors 3 and 4. She'll be in and out daily through Friday, so rather than escorting her every time, we've cleared her for a temporary door pass. Please log her in each morning and hand over the code below.

turnstile pass: bdg-NZJSS-18109